- [ ] **Step 7: Breaker override escrow.** After sealing the signing keys for the Tallgrove upstream API circuit breaker, confirm the support team can force the breaker open during a full outage. The override bundle lives in the sealed escrow drawer and is useless without its unlock phrase. Two ceremony witnesses must initial this step before proceeding. The escrow bundle is decrypted with the recovery passphrase that follows.

vault phrase of kahip-kahop = holath-quenmir

**Break-Glass Access: Cron Drift Investigation (Oakspur cluster)**

Context: scheduled jobs on Oakspur drifting up to 40s; suspect NTP peer misconfig on node pool C. Normal access insufficient — node-level clock inspection requires break-glass. Procedure: file a BG request, ping the duty lead, then use the emergency console. Access expires after 2h; all actions logged. The console prompts for the break-glass recovery passphrase, recorded below for the sync.

strongbox words: norwyn-wenael-aldvan-aldiel-wendor-holael

Handover note — Olan to whoever inherits SweepJack, the orphaned-resource sweeper on the Tidemark cluster. It runs nightly, flags volumes and load balancers with no owning deployment, and deletes them after a 72-hour grace window. Logs land in the audit bucket. To unlock the sweeper's recovery vault, use the passphrase written below.

vault phrase of bagaf-kajeg = jorath-feniel-briir-siliel-ralix

**Deploy Guide — Step 4: Health checks behind the Relaywing LB** Plugin authors: once your plugin container is registered, the Relaywing load balancer probes `/healthz` every ten seconds. Probes are authenticated, so unauthenticated containers get marked unhealthy and drained even if they're fine. Your plugin must read the probe credential from its env file at startup. Before deploying, make sure the env file includes this line:

env line for fafof-fahag: LEDGER_TOKEN5=f8790